FAQs
What is the commitment duration for the Summer Camp Early Childhood Teacher position?
The position requires a commitment of three to ten weeks, preferably for a minimum of 3-5 weeks.
What are the working hours for this position?
The work schedule is Monday-Friday for approximately eight hours per day.
What is the age range of campers I will be supervising?
You will be supervising campers aged 4-12 during all activities.
Is prior teaching experience required for this position?
Yes, prior child management experience is required, along with a basic understanding of baseball.
Do I need to provide my own transportation?
Yes, you are required to have reliable transportation to travel to each camp site.
What is the hourly compensation for this position?
The compensation is $22.00/hour for Professional Educators with at least one school year of paid teaching experience or proven teaching certification. For college students or recent graduates still pursuing a teaching credential, the rate is $18.67/hour.
When do the Giants Baseball & Softball Camps run?
The camps run every week from June 9, 2025, to August 15, 2025.
What is the interview process like for this position?
After your application is submitted, you will receive an invitation to complete a one-way interview, followed by a 15-minute virtual interview with the MLB Camps Director. The final decision will be made after this.
